Which intensity descriptor denotes the Spatial Peak Temporal Peak value?

Explanation:
Intensities in ultrasound are described by combining where the energy is in space with how it behaves over time. The descriptor that captures the maximum instantaneous value at the beam’s strongest point in space is the spatial peak temporal peak value, abbreviated as SPTP. It represents the peak intensity reached at the location of highest spatial intensity, measured at the exact moment of the peak, without averaging over time. In contrast, SPPA is the average intensity during the pulse at the spatial peak, SPTA is the average over time at the spatial peak, and SATA is the average over both space and time. So the peak instantaneous value, at the point of maximum spatial intensity, is what SPTP describes.
